If you are a new Type 2 often exercise can bring your BG down quickly. At first I could bring my BG down 10 to 20mm/DL if I did the following: 20 to 60 seconds of jumping jacks, followed quickly by 15 to 60 deep knee bends, then 10 to 60 wall pushups and finally 20 to 60 seconds of wall sits.

Of course now after a year and 1/2 that would only move 5mm/DLL

But I have other tricks up my sleeve like building muscle mass and eating LCHF diet basically no processed food including pasta cakes and bread

Why don't you snack on high calories low carb things likes nuts or cheese as this would be much better for you than filling up on carbs which are definitely raising your bloods. You could also perhaps try some nut or seed based snacks such as 9Bars or something similar. That way you can keep your intake of calories up - whilst keeping your BS lower. Also depending on what you are eating, it might be worth increasing the fat intake, ie have butter on your veg or olive oil on your salad as I believe this can also slow down the impact on carbs...this may be stuff that your already doing.. but based on what I know - I don't think its good to go so high BS wise on a regular basis.
